When thumbnails back up in the Ferngate render queue, first check worker liveness before draining anything — a drain during active renders corrupts partial outputs. The queue admin API on the Mosswell cluster requires authenticated requests for every drain, pause, or requeue action. Authenticate your session using the key below.

service key, fawip-bajef: kto11_Qt5wZK9vdNC

## Ticket: Config drift in Keyturn rotation utility

While auditing last week's release, I found that the Keyturn secrets-rotation utility in staging no longer matches what we deployed to production. Someone hand-edited the rotation interval and the grace window in staging, and those edits were never backported. This caused two rotations to overlap during the Marrowfield test run. Before we cut the next release, please reconcile both environments against the intended baseline, which is recorded below.

deployment values, faduf-tawep:
SORDOR_LOG_LEVEL=error
SORDOR_METRICS_HOST=metrics.sordor.nelvrolabs.internal
SORDOR_POOL_SIZE=4

# RemindRx Environments

RemindRx is the appointment reminder job for the Ashgrove clinic network. It runs in three environments: dev (synthetic patients only), staging (mirrors production schedules one day behind), and production. Support team: reminder sends only occur in production; staging logs what it would have sent. If a clinic reports missing reminders, check the staging log first to rule out scheduling issues. Production currently runs with the following configuration.

service settings:
HOLIX_HOST=holix.qorvelsys.internal
HOLIX_PORT=7000

## Deploying the Gatewick Proctor Queue

Deploys are pretty painless: push to main, wait for the pipeline, then watch the queue drain dashboard for five minutes. If candidates pile up mid-exam, roll back first and ask questions later — the queue replays safely. Everything the workers care about lives in one config block, shown here for reference.

settings of bafof-yagef:
JOROX_PIN=8740
JOROX_TENANT=pelox
JOROX_METRICS_HOST=metrics.jorox.qorvelworks.internal
JOROX_SEAL=seal_c78f63c1
JOROX_STANDBY_TEAM=norax